Iraq vs. Norway
Game context
Norway enters the 2026 FIFA World Cup opener against Iraq as heavy favorites due to superior squad depth and attacking firepower, anchored by Erling Haaland’s prolific scoring and Martin Ødegaard’s midfield control. The Norwegians return after a 28-year absence following an undefeated UEFA qualifying campaign that featured dominant results and Haaland’s record international goal tally. Iraq, appearing for the first time since 1986 after a late intercontinental playoff qualification, rely on a compact defensive structure and counter-attacking threat under coach Graham Arnold but face a significant gap in resources and recent competitive pedigree against European opposition.
